Metal Products Production and Consumption for 5 months 2019 in Ukraine
According to Association UKRMETALURGPROM, for 5 months of 2019 Ukrainian steelmakers had produced 7.92 Mt of metal products (102.6% to the same period of 2018) of which, according to ETR-Spectr Ltd, up to 6.86 Mt (or 86.6%) had been exported. For the same period of 2018 the share of export was 83.2% (6.43 Mt with the total metal products production up to 7.72 Mt).
The semi-products’ share in the total export for 5 months 2019 was 45.39% that is a noticeably higher than within Jan-May of 2018 (42.16%). The share of flat products for 5 months 2019 is equal to this indicator for the same period of 2018 (34.00% for both); the share of long products in the total export for 5 months 2019 is lower than for the same period of 2018 (29.62% and 23.84% respectively).
The total domestic demand for metal products within 5 months 2019 was 1607.3 Kt, of which 543.3 Kt or 33.8% had been imported. For the same period of 2018 the domestic consumption was 1843.8 Kt of which 545.8 Kt or 29.6% were imported. Therefore, for 5 months 2019 the domestic demand for metal products had reduced on 12.8% comparatively to the same period of 2018, but the import component had increased (+4.2%).
The peculiarity of the metal products import structure for 5 months 2019 is the noticeable dominating of flat products over long products (52.94% and 41.73% respectively); within the same period of 2018 the long products share was higher than the flat products share (49.55% and 47.23% respectively).
Main markets of the Ukrainian steel products, according to ETR Spectr Ltd, for Jan-May of 2019 are EU-28 (31.9%), African countries (18.1%) and Middle East (11.1%)
Among main steel importers for 5 months 2019, the first position belongs to CIS (55.1 ), second to EU-28 (17.9%), third – to Asian countries (15.1%).
